It\u2019s 2019 and we\u2019re still talking about age-gating. Last week, Tinder and Grindr were in the spotlight after a report from the Sunday Times showed children as young as eight were listed on dating apps, and detectives have investigated more than 30 incidents of child abuse and rape, linked to dating sites. <\/span><\/p>\n

It\u2019s still so easy for people to fake their age online. We can\u2019t rely on people to be truthful; lying about age is just something people do. Children always want to be older and adults always want to be younger. At 12, you say you\u2019re 15. At 15, you say you\u2019re 18. At 40, you say you\u2019re 35. <\/span><\/p>\n

The difference is that when you\u2019re young, you don\u2019t necessarily think about the consequences of lying about your age. So as adults, it\u2019s our responsibility to protect children, even when they don\u2019t know they need it. <\/span><\/p>\n

I\u2019ve been talking to brands and sites about the tricky issue of age-gating, or age verification, for as long as I\u2019ve been in social media. What\u2019s changed in the last 10 or so years is that technology has moved on and while no system is perfect, there are systems now that put checks in place that are far more sophisticated than simply asking someone what year they were born. <\/span><\/p>\n

As ever, the industries with the most to lose – particularly gambling and alcohol where companies could lose their licence to operate if they\u2019re associated with under-age use – are leading the way. Financial services companies<\/a>, too, use ID verification technology to prove customers are who they say they are (some are asking customers to use their own smartphones to take a selfie and then a photo of their ID – a really simple way to verify identity). Age verification hubs (such as Yoti) – where you provide your ID once and then use the app to prove your age to multiple sites – are becoming more widely used. \u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n

There\u2019s really no excuse not to invest in these new technologies to provide age gates to younger users. We\u2019re not talking about small sites with shallow pockets, here. Protecting young users from harm is society\u2019s collective responsibility, of course. But the burden falls particularly heavily on those sites who are actively putting young people in potentially dangerous situations. <\/span><\/p>\n

After all, if The Sunday Times can find out the ages of young users on dating sites, presumably so can the sites themselves.<\/span><\/p>\n
